Abstract
A new method is proposed to produce gold
nanoparticles (GNP) by in situ reduction of a gold salt
dissolved in water. The reducing agent used is Tiron
instead of the citrate anion most often mentioned in
literature. The influence of various parameters has
been investigated, such as the content of Tiron with
respect to that of the precursor of gold HAuCl4, or the
initial pH of the solution after mixing of reactants. It is
shown that Tiron also exerts a positive influence as a
dispersant, which impedes agglomeration of gold
nanoparticles. The typical average size of GNP synthesized
in the present work is close to 7 nm.
